Jordi Oller

Experto tiendas virtuales online Magento, Prestashop.

Cuando escoger Prestashop o Shopify – Cronologia

Después de 24 años (1999) dedicado al ecommerce y sus diferentes CMS, la respuesta es «DEPENDE».

Elegir entre prestashop y shopify

Si hacemos un poco de cronología de cms ecommerce y recapitulando un poco su historia –> conozco y he realizado tiendas en los siguientes CMS:

  • PHP-nuke 1999 – 2000 las primeras tiendas que hice personalmente, básicas y sencillas, muchos errores y mucho código PHP fue la razón por la que aprendí este primer lenguaje de programación.
  • Oscommerce salió inmediatamente en el año 2000 (administré el foro oficial de este CMS durante bastantes años, hasta que finalmente murió), se crearon las primeras grandes tiendas de españa con este software (de las que fuí partícipe en algunas), y que hoy aún no se atreven a cambiar ni migrar tras +20 años de personalizaciones. Cabe decir que en comparación con otros CMS, su simpleza de código hace volar en velocidad y navegabilidad a las mismas sin igual, no hay otro CMS que vaya tan rápido como este a dia de hoy. Si su creador Harald Ponce de Leon no lo hubiera abandonado durante tantos años, hoy seria aún el software de referencia para crear tiendas online (Lo relanzó casi una década después, pero ya era demasiado tarde)
  • Zencart –> salió poco despues en 2003, muchos oscommerce migraron rápidamente a Zencart que ofrecia mejores personalizaciones y módulos que su antecesor.
  • Opencart –> salió en 2005 como primer CMS sériamente con módulos instalables en un clic y una estructura limpia, con código impecable y fluidez. La falta de marketing de la empresa madre no lo acabó de catapultar para ser un referente, una verdadera lástima.
  • Shopify –> aunque salió en 2006 no fué hasta el covid en 2020 que se hizo realmente famosa en todo el mundo por su sencillez de creación de tiendas online en un modelo as a service y todas sus herramientas anexas, y su gran cantidad de módulos de pago de terceros para nutrirlas. Sobretodo lo que supieron hacer en Shopify fue una gran campaña de marketing en redes sociales, planes de pago muy baratos y nuevas herramientas que hizo explotar finalmente este sistema.
  • Vtex –> salió en 2007 concretamente al público, a partir de una empresa que realizaba desarrollos ecommerce con su propio desarrollo privativo que usaba para sus clientes. Desde ese año lo abrieron y empezaron a vender como modelo saas a la estela de shopify en brasil y fue especializandose poco a poco hacia marcas grandes que se lo pudieran permitir por sus precios y grado de especialización/personalización siempre con acompañamiento de un consultor experto. (En este sistema no he creado ninguna tienda hasta la fecha por su hermetismo y foco a grandes jugadores).
  • Prestashop salió en 2007 y lo cambió todo (almenos en Europa), con su flamante carrito flotante al añadir los productos a la cesta (sobrevolando este carrito por encima de la tienda), fue el efecto diferenciador que atrajo la curiosidad de miles de usuarios con este simpático efecto y su de AVATAR que muchos confunden con un pato pero se trata de un frailecillo «Preston» de aquí su nombre. Seguiamos por aquel entonces manteniendo multitud de Oscommerces y Zencarts, pero poco a poco se iban migrando a esta plataforma.
  • Magento salió a la estela en 2008 y probamos algunas tiendas, pero su estructura y backoffice no eran tan atractivos para el usuario final (al cabo de pocos años se acababan migrando a otro CMS), no obstante para tiendas con mucho catalogo (cientos de miles de referencias) aguantaba mucho mejor que Prestashop y decidimos que para grandes tiendas seria la mejor opción. Al poco tiempo salió Magento Enterprise, para dar una solución a grandes jugadores tal y como estaba haciendo Vtex (murió su continuidad en 2014 concretamente), y por otro lado lanzó tambien su MAGENTO go, para dar salida a la vertiente SAAS como shopify. Lamentablemente Magento go tampoco tuvo éxito por sus pocas opciones de personalización y acabó cerrando. Finalmente Adobe lo acabó comprando en 2018 y le cambió el naming a Adobe commerce, sin embago sigue siendo la misma base Magento 2.x con multiples mejoras y en estados unidos esta bastante establecida, pero a mi parecer tiene los dias contados a menos que saque una actualización disruptiva en los próximos años.
  • Bigcommerce salió en 2009 como modelo saas y claro competidor de Shopify, aunque no ha alcanzado la popularidad global de éste, si que se ha establecido fuertemente en USA. (Nosotros no hemos hecho realmente ninguna tienda en este sistema, ya que consideramos que para modelo SAAS shopify ya cumple nuestras espectativas).
  • Woocommerce salió en 2011, y muchos blogueros vieron una posibilidad fácil de vender sus artículos sin necesidad de una tienda separada, pudiendo utilizar el mismo usuario de WordPress y relacionar los posts con sus productos, fue un gran hito también en los CMS ecommerce, aunque su estructura dejaba mucho que desear, al convertir los POSTS WP normales a productos (añadiendole nuevos inputs, formularios y características), en un intento de asemejarlo a un ecommerce de pleno, lo que creó muchisimos problemas que con los años fueron resolviendo. Para grandes blogs y bien posicionados es la opción perfecta para implementar su ecommerce sin grandes complicaciones.

 

En todos estos CMS hemos desarrollado tiendas exceptuando VTEX y Bigcommerce. y podemos decir que las mejores opciones tras más de dos décadas de desarrollos y bajo nuestra experiencia son Prestashop y Shopify.

¿Ahora bien cuando escoger Prestashop o shopify?

  1. Recomendaciones para escoger Prestashop:
    • Cuando se requiera un diseño y programación muy personalizados al detalle (Actualmente con constructores «Elementor» que facilitan como en WordPress su edición al límite, sumando con capas de programación y módulos añadidos que en Shopify es imposible juntarlo todo en uno como hace prestashop)
    • Para cuando el modelo de venta o por tipología de producto, es especialmente compleja. (Ejemplo constructor de productos, suscripciones variables).
    • Indicado para grandes catálogos y su mantenimento, si bien el predilecto para esta situación ha sido siempre Magento… Prestashop 8 se ha puesto a la altura y ya no se queda atrás en este sentido, y más si lo unimos a herramientas de tratamiento como store managers o similares.
    • Cuando no se quiere pagar fees mensuales por módulos, ni comisiones por las ventas como hace Shopify, ni un mantenimiento mensual obligado (que a la larga se convierte en un sueldo más fijo en la tienda). Prestashop consume muy pocos recursos y con un servidor compartido de 10-15 €/mes y los módulos indispensables que se pagan 1 sola vez y luego un mantenimiento anual mínimo, ya puedes surgir con tu tienda, sin ningún otro tipo de comisión ni gasto oculto (Eso si, necesitarás un programador experto prestashop que te ayude a crearla y ponerla a punto, como en cualquier otro CMS).
    • Cuando quieres usar módulos y servicios españoles o Europeos, Prestashop está mucho mejor adaptado a la comunidad española y latina. Pues shopify tiene muchos inconvenientes con procesadores de pagos (como redsys y otros), que no estan disponibles, y de la misma forma carriers de transporte y servicios similares.
    • Recomendado para hacer sites multitienda, o en multiidioma, Prestashop está especialmente preparado y bien diseñado para ello.
    • Recomendado para hacer marketplaces de venta,  donde otros vendedores pueden vender sus productos en tu tienda y tú ganar comision por ello.
    • Cuando tienes que conectar un ERP a tu ecommerce (exceptuando SAP que tiene su sap ecommerce cloud), como SAGE, A3ERP o incluso ERPs desconocidos, Prestashop dispone de potentes conectores que te facilitaran la vida e incluso una API para conectar erps menores de una manera super sencilla, sobretodo aterrizado en ERPs españoles y europeos.
  2. Recomendaciones para escoger Shopify:
    • Se recomienda escoger shopify cuando quieres tener tu tienda lista para vender en 24 horas o menos, lanzada y con tu propio dominio. Es la opción perfecta para empezar a vender casi de inmediato. Sin programadores por medio para tiendas sencillas, self made puedes lanzarte a vender colgando tú mismo los productos y habilitando los módulos que necesites y con una plantilla predefinida.
    • Es recomendable tambien para catalogos de productos no muy extensos para su facil gestión desde su propio backoffice, que aunque tambien tiene conectores para ERPs externos, nos han presentado varias dificultades y su soporte no es tan ágil como pueda ser en otros CMS.
    • Cuando no se tenga demasiado presupuesto inicial shopify es la opción perfecta para un gasto simbólico inicial (pero recurrente y en aumento).
    • Para venta de monoproductos, o productos efímeros. Creando una página o mejor dicho landing para la venta casual o efímera facilmente que se levante o cierre en pocos clics para la venta dirigida desde ads o campañas sociales e influencers.
    • Cuanto tienes una tienda física, su modalidad de POS-TPV hoy en dia es una de las mejores del mercado y totalmente conectada a tu tienda online.
    • Cuando no quieres lidiar con programadores, ni preocuparte de servidores ni hostings complejos, solo has de pagar un fee mensual. El problema aquí es que si tu tienda crece, necesitaras de un consultor experto shopify  para ayudarte en tu crecimiento y estrategia.
    • Para cuando no tienes mucho tiempo para administrar tu tienda online, el Backoffice de shopify es mucho más reducido e intuitivo quitando herramientas complejas que no vayas a utilizar (para esto estaran los plugins extras).

 

Aunque nos hemos encontrado en ambas situaciones, Shopifys, Magentos, Woocomerce que se deciden migrar a Prestashop, y viceversa Prestashops, Magentos, Woocommerce que deciden migrar a Shopify, claramente es por tomar la primera mala decisión sobre que CMS escoger, asi que si tienes dudas a la hora de crear o migrar tu actual tienda CMS, porfavor no dudes en contactarme y amablemente te diré sin cobrarte absolutamente nada si es una buena decisión o no, y los pros y contras! 🙂

Prestashop 8 beta ya disponible

Esta misma semana se ha hecho pública al fin la descarga de Prestashop 8 beta, que incluye las siguientes  mejoras:

  • Actualización a Symfony 4.4
  • Compatbilidad con PHP 8 y 8.1
  • Rediseño de la página de ficha de producto.
  • Nueva zona en backoffice en «Parametros avanzados» para centralizar la seguridad y checks de privacidad sobre los usuarios de tu prestashop.
  • Se eliminan las colaboraciones de pago como en 1.6 y 1.7 con Paypal u otros comerciantes, es la primera release totalmente neutral y limpia que se lanza desde hace muchísimo tiempo.

Prestashop 8

Link de descarga aquí.  Si necesitas empezar a migrar/actualizar tu tienda a Prestashop 8, ya puedes comenzar a investigarlo en un entorno separado o local, para comprobar módulos, empezar a trabajar tu plantilla y su compatibilidad, o bien contactame como experto prestashop para ayudarte en este proceso y llevar la transición sin que tengas problemas durante este cambio.

Ataque masivo a tiendas online Prestashop

Como si del robo de casas y chalets durante el verano se tratara (en ausencia de los propietarios), se está perpetrando durante el verano ataques masivos a tiendas online Prestashop (aprovechando el periodo vacacional) debido a un bug reportado por la filial en unos de sus componentes, el cual tuvo que hacerlo público el pasado 22 de Julio de 2022.

Básicamente se trata de un ataque por SQL injection, en los que por síntomas generales tras el ataque son:

  1. Creación de un archivo blm.php en la raíz (si lo ves elimínalo cuanto antes).
  2. Luego inyectan un pago por tarjeta falso en JS que se superpone en el checkout a cualquier otro proceso, por lo tanto los clientes al llegar al checkout lo primero que ven es un formulario para introducir los datos de la tarjeta, que iran a parar directo al atacante.

Bug prestashop

Pasos para detener el ataque urgentemente:

  1. Poner tu tienda en mantenimiento cuanto antes
  2. Actualizar tu tienda a la última versión de prestashop que corrige este bug.
  3. Sino puedes actualizar tu tienda debido a la personalización que tienes en la misma, entonces debes ir a este archivo !config/smarty.config.inc.php» y comentar estas lineas:
if (Configuration::get('PS_SMARTY_CACHING_TYPE') == 'mysql') {
    include _PS_CLASS_DIR_.'Smarty/SmartyCacheResourceMysql.php';
    $smarty->caching_type = 'mysql';
}

Con esto limpiamos la cache de nuestra tienda, y estaremos protegidos ante este ataque de SQL injection.

Si necesitas más ayuda no dudes en contactarme como experto pretashop urgentemente.

Actualizar a la nueva versión Prestashop 8

Felices fiestas a todos antes que nada!

Aprovecho esta época decembrina más calmada para redactar el último post del año 2021, y es que ante las puertas del año nuevo, Prestashop ha avanzado que sacará su primera release estable en Abril de 2022 y una final release de la misma a mediados de año.

Si eres de los early adopters y te atreves a actualizar tu prestashop 1.7 a la nueva versión 8 (en realidad sería la 1.8) deberás saber que novedades trae esta versión antes de tomar esta decisión:

Prestashop 8

 

  • Será compatible con la nueva versión de PHP 8.x , y adaptarse así a los nuevos tiempos que vienen
  • Actualización a a Symfony 4.4
  • Limpieza de librerias obsoletas y componentes menores
  • Renovada la página de gestión de producto, totalmente a través de symfony y que nos alegrará a todos por la facilidad para la gestión de productos con combinaciones.
  • Separación del proyecto opensource de la empresa madre Prestashop, por lo que Prestashop 8 ya no vendrá con el addons marketplace en su core.
  • Prestashop 8 ya no dependerá tampoco de las famosas APIs de consulta a Prestashop.com que tantos estragos hicieron en pandemia y antes de la misma, cuando el servidor de Prestashop se caía… todos los prestashops del mundo que tenían el plugin de gamificación y de update de addons dejaron de funcionar…. un completo desastre –> por fin decidieron eliminar esta capa de APIs.

 

A lo largo de estos meses, nos irán dando más datos sobre este Major update de Prestashop 8, así que habrá que estar atento a todas las noticias que van saliendo al respecto para poder empezar a clonar nuestro site y probar y testear pronto las nuevas mejoras que traerá esta versión.

Adaptar Prestashop a la normativa IVA – VAT Europeo

En la empresa ya llevamos decenas de tiendas actualizadas estas dos primeras semanas que ha entrado en vigor esta nueva ley, en la que nos obligan a mostrar y vender los productos con el IVA correspondiente al país del cliente final que efectua la compra.

Resumen de IVA – VAT general actualizado en 2024 (no trataremos los reducidos):

  • AUSTRIA (AT) = 20 %
  • BELGICA (BE) = 21%
  • BULGARIA (BG) = 20%
  • CROACIA (HR) = 25%
  • CHIPRE (CY) = 19%
  • REPÚBLICA CHECA (CZ) = 21%
  • DINAMARCA (DK) = 25%
  • ESTONIA (EE) = 22% (antes 20%)
  • FINLANDIA (FI) = 24%
  • FRANCIA (FR) = 20%
  • ALEMANIA (DE) = 19%
  • GRECIA (GR) = 24%
  • HUNGRIA (HU) = 27%
  • IRLANDA (IE) = 23%
  • ITALIA (IT) = 22%
  • LETONIA (LV) = 21%
  • LITUANIA (LT) = 21%
  • LUXEMBURGO (LX) = 17%
  • MALTA (MT) = 18%
  • PAISES BAJOS (NL) = 21%
  • POLONIA (PL) = 23%
  • PORTUGAL (PT) = 23%
  • RUMANIA (RO) = 19%
  • ESLOVAQUIA (SK)= 20%
  • ESLOVENIA (SI) = 22%
  • ESPAÑA (ES) = 21%
  • SUECIA (SE) = 25%
  • REINO UNIDO (UK) –> Eliminar tras el brexit.

 

PASO 1: Configuración impuestos intracomunitarios en Prestashop

En el administrador de prestashop, Internacional –> Impuestos comprobar los porcentages que estan bien y activados (si se borraron en su día, se tendrán que añadir a mano 1 a 1) y deberiamos ver algo similar a esto (obviaré los reducidos en este post):

IVAS prestashop nueva ley

 

PASO 2: Configuración reglas de impuestos intracomunitarios en Prestashop

2.1 Nos vamos a reglas de impuestos, justo la pestaña derecha y seleccionamos la regla (equivocada ya) de «ES IVA Standard rate 21%»

2.2 Le cambiaremos el nombre por el de IVA o VAT INTRACOMUNITARIO (al haberse unificado todo el sistema de impuestos a nivel Europeo).

2.3 Ahora añadiremos todos los paises 1 a 1, con el impuesto que le pertoca a cada uno (sin combinar).

IVAS VAT Intracomunitario europa

 

 

PASO 3: testear las nuevas reglas de IVA – VAT intracomunitario

  • Guardamos la nueva regla
  • Comprobar que todos los productos estan asignados a esta nueva regla

 

Ficha producto pretashop IVA intracomunitario

 

  • Y finalmente comprobar que el IVA – VAT intracomunitario cambia con las diferentes direcciones en el CHECKOUT.

 

Muchas gracias! para cualquier duda en la que necesites un experto pretashop , no dudes en contactarme por el chat o mi whatsapp directo 668828382.

 

 

 

 

× Habla conmigo